OIt’s valid for all Exec Club members irrespective of card color. It may however book into a specific BA CDP. Why don’t you try to recreate the booking on avisba.com and see if you can get the same rate - plus the free 2nd driver.

From the avis /ba t&c’s:

This benefit is available for British Airways Executive Club Members only, all membership tiers, booking on ba.com; avisba.com; BA Call Centres or Avis Call Centres using a BA Executive Club AWD: Gold N744400; Silver N744300; Blue N744100; Bronze N284300.

Rentals made using Avis contracted (corporate/government) rates/AWDs, chauffeur drive, or van rentals do not qualify. Travel industry staff rates including BA and Avis employee programs, replacement/insurance rates, selected association programs, and net rate programmes, and rentals booked with online travel agents (with the exception of ba.com), brokers and price comparison sites do not qualify.

Status is irrelevant, but to get the free additional driver you have to use one of the BA rates, the relevant AWDs are:

Gold - N744400
Silver - N744300
Bronze – N284300
Blue - N744100
General Passenger - N743700
